Lightest Fraction

In petrochemistry, refers to the fraction of a crude oil that contains the lightest, most volatile components, such as gases and small hydrocarbons.

Volatile Components

Substances that can easily vaporize at room temperature or under mild heating, often contributing to the aroma of foods or products.

Gas Chromatography

An analytical method used to separate and analyze compounds that can be vaporized without decomposition, often used in chemistry for identifying substances within a test sample.
